OSHA Inspection: NARITA MANUFACTURING, INC.

Complaint inspection · Health discipline

On , OSHA opened a complaint health inspection of NARITA MANUFACTURING, INC. in 828 LANDMARK DRIVE, BELVIDERE, IL 61008 (NAICS 336510). OSHA activity number 339583767.

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.95(c)(1): The employer did not administer a continuing, effective hearing conservation program as described in 29 CFR 1910.9(c) through (o) whenever employee noise exposures equal or exceed an 8-hour time-weighted average sound level of 85 decibels measured on the A scale, or equivalently a dose of fifty percent:  Welding Department: The employer did not implement a Hearing Conservation Program.    Welding Department:  The welder performing grinding operation was exposed to noise at 69.1% of the permissible daily exposure (8-hour time weighted average of 90 dBA) or the equivalent sound level of approximately 87.1 dBA during a 430 minutes sampling period on 2/19/14: exposure calculation includes a zero increment for the 50 minutes not sampled.
